Why Teach at Paideia?
Teaching at Paideia is different from teaching in a traditional classroom.
Our hybrid model combines the best of classroom instruction with parent-supported learning at home. Students attend classes twice each week, while parents guide learning during the remaining days using prepared curriculum and online resources.
As a teacher, your role is to:
Inspire students through engaging classroom instruction
Bring curriculum to life through discussion, projects, demonstrations, and labs
Encourage students to ask thoughtful questions and think critically
Partner with parents as they continue learning at home
Because the curriculum, scope and sequence, and online coursework is already developed, teachers are able to focus on what they do best: building relationships with students and making learning meaningful.

What You'll Do
Hybrid teachers:
Teach small classes in a welcoming classroom environment
Implement a prepared curriculum
Expand lessons through projects, demonstrations, discussion, and hands-on learning
Grade a small number of assignments each week using Canvas
Communicate with parents regarding student learning
Collaborate with fellow teachers and staff
Class sizes are intentionally small, allowing teachers to know their students well and create meaningful learning experiences.
Schedule & Compensation
Part-time hourly positions
Starting from $35 per instructional hour
Paid weekly preparation hours
Flexible schedule
Small class sizes
Supportive, collaborative faculty
Curriculum and classroom resources provided
Our hybrid core classes meet twice each week throughout the school year, allowing teachers to balance teaching with other professional and personal commitments.
